Mystartsearch.com Removal Guide

Do you know what mystartsearch.com is?

It is advisable to get rid of mystartsearch.com if you notice that it has replaced your homepage and default search provider. You should especially do that if these changes have been made without your permission. Have you agreed with the changes yourself? If so, you should still get rid of mystartsearch.com because it cannot be trusted completely. The researchers of spyware-techie.com have even found out that mystartsearch.com belongs to the family of such browser hijackers as Qone8, Webssearches, Sweet-page, V9, and similar. There are many other more reliable search engines out there; thus, you should better use them instead of mystartsearch.com.

mystartsearch.com itself looks decent at first sight. It enables computer users to search for different kinds of information, including images, videos, news and games. In addition, it will allow users to access such websites as Facebook, YouTube, eBay, and Yahoo! in just one click. Unfortunately, mystartsearch.com is more suspicious than reliable, which is why we recommend that you carefully think whether you want to use it. As the research has shown, mystartsearch.com might present you with ads and sponsored links. You might even download suspicious programs on the system because the icons that will redirect you to their websites (e.g. yet-another-cleaner.en.softonic.com) might be placed on the startup page.Mystartsearch.com Removal GuideMystartsearch.com screenshot
Scroll down for full removal instructions

Another suspicious fact about mystartsearch.com is the observation that it will install QuickStart and SupTab extensions alongside. As it has been found out, they will change your New Tab. Remove mystartsearch.com

Windows 8

  1. Tap the Windows key + R.
  2. Enter control panel in the Open box and click OK.
  3. Select Uninstall a program.
  4. Right-click on the unwanted program and then click Uninstall.

Windows 7 and Vista

  1. Open the Start menu.
  2. Select Control Panel.
  3. Click Uninstall a program.
  4. Select the suspicious application.
  5. Delete it by clicking Uninstall.

Windows XP

  1. Click on the Start button and then open Control Panel.
  2. Click Add or Remove Programs.
  3. Click on mystartsearch.com entry.
  4. Remove it from the system.

Google Chrome

  1. Launch your browser and tap Alt+F.
  2. Select Settings.
  3. Click Show advanced settings.
  4. Select Reset browser settings and then click the Reset button.

Mozilla Firefox

  1. Open your browser and tap Alt+H.
  2. Select Troubleshooting Information from the Help menu.
  3. Click Reset Firefox.
  4. Click the Reset Firefox button again.

Internet Explorer

  1. Open your browser.
  2. Tap Alt+T and go to Internet Options.
  3. Open the Advanced tab.
  4. Click Reset.
  5. Mark Delete personal settings.
  6. Click the Reset button again.
